Output 4266b5a2a876c11e69f354bb04fc82fddc2d4c6da0283ede45b2427660fccb1f:0

value
752318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f5b10faf68a80f39fd7f4785937e9b505c33cb3 OP_EQUAL
address
361QmxbG1SLR3fdTUZZjcs6WHYTLCQ6knU
transaction
4266b5a2a876c11e69f354bb04fc82fddc2d4c6da0283ede45b2427660fccb1f
spent
true